What is the Goethe Certificate C2?
The Goethe Certificate C2 is granted by the Goethe-Institut, a worldwide renowned cultural institute promoting the German language and culture. It is developed for positive and experienced speakers of German who intend to display their linguistic aptitude at an academically and expertly high requirement.

Being a CEFR Level C2 accreditation, it validates that the speaker can:

Understand virtually everything heard or check out in German.
Sum up and analyze complex info from various spoken and written sources.
Express themselves spontaneously, properly, and fluently in professional, scholastic, or social discussions.
Present arguments, viewpoints, and analyses in a nuanced way.
Acquiring this accreditation frequently serves as proof for German universities, international companies, and migration authorities that the candidate possesses native-like proficiency over the language.

Exam Structure
The Goethe Certificate C2 exam includes 4 modules, each designed to assess a core proficiency in the German language. All modules can be taken together or separately:

Reading (Lesen):.
Prospects are examined on their capability to comprehend and analyze complicated texts, such as scholastic papers, newspaper short articles, or fictional works.

Listening (Hören):.
This module evaluates understanding of numerous spoken materials, consisting of news broadcasts, discussions, or discussions on abstract topics.

Composing (Schreiben):.
Test-takers need to produce meaningful, well-structured, and grammatically complicated written texts, such as essays or detailed reports.

Speaking (Sprechen):.
In the speaking module, individuals are anticipated to participate in disputes, offer discussions, and supply intricate, clear arguments throughout discussions.

FAQs.
1. Just how much does it cost to take the Goethe Certificate C2 exam?
The exam expenses vary by area and test center but generally range in between EUR200 and EUR300. Constantly inspect the fees with your closest Goethe-Institut.

2. How long is the Goethe Certificate C2 valid?
Unlike lots of language accreditations, the Goethe Certificate never ever ends. It works as a long-lasting testimony to your C2-level proficiency in German.

3. Is the C2 level difficult to achieve?
Yes, the C2 level is difficult and frequently equated to native-speaker fluency. However, with devotion, strategic learning resources, and practical exposure, it is completely achievable.

4. Can I retake specific modules if I fail?
Yes, you can retake specific modules rather of the entire exam, making it easier to focus on specific areas where improvement is required.

5. For how long does it require to prepare for C2 accreditation?
Preparation time depends upon your current proficiency. Advanced learners may require 6 months to a year, whereas intermediate students may need 1-2 years of constant practice.
